Transaction 2ae89a25e061d4048144795d4ddfd04dac45d98160265d6260cb2a4b3267d0d4
2 Input
2 Outputs
- 2ae89a25e061d4048144795d4ddfd04dac45d98160265d6260cb2a4b3267d0d4:0
- 2ae89a25e061d4048144795d4ddfd04dac45d98160265d6260cb2a4b3267d0d4:1
value 14226153
address 3LsEYKkfgMLYD5HEh1MuDnXsdTkc3FLK9x
value 1605700
address 1AnjyGA8mDQDSNYBEnBAeEB8NyjZUXMQfe